Basic Operation
The MCU can be controlled using the Collaboration Server Web Client and the RMX Manager application.
The most common operations performed via these applications are:
Starting, monitoring and managing conferences
Monitoring and managing participants and endpoints as individuals or groups.
Participant – A person using an endpoint to connect to a conference. When using a Room
System, several participants use a single endpoint.
Endpoint – A hardware device, or set of devices, that can call, and be called by an MCU or
another endpoint. For example, an endpoint can be a phone, a camera and microphone
connected to a PC or an integrated Room System (conferencing system).
Group – A group of participants or endpoints with a common name.
Starting the Collaboration Server Web Client
You start the Collaboration Server Web Client by connecting to the MCU system. To connect to the MCU
you need to get the following information from your system administrator:
User name
Password
MCU Control Unit IP Address
